This ebook consists of a summary of the ideas, viewpoints and facts presented by John Micklethwait and Adrian Wooldridge in his book “The Right Nation: How Conservatives Won”. This summary offers a concise overview of the entire book in less than 30 minutes reading time. However this work does not replace in any case John Micklethwait’s and Adrian Wooldridge’s book.
Micklethwait and Wooldridge explore and explain the conservative nature of American politics at the 21st century.
